Identifying Authentic Vintage Chanel Jewelry: A Collector's Guide
Authenticating vintage Chanel jewelry requires a keen eye for detail and a thorough understanding of the brand's evolution in design and manufacturing techniques. Vintage pieces often possess a unique charm and patina that modern reproductions struggle to replicate. However, this very patina can also make authentication more difficult, as wear and tear can obscure markings.
Several key factors distinguish authentic vintage Chanel jewelry:
* Hallmarks and Markings: Genuine Chanel jewelry, both vintage and contemporary, bears specific hallmarks. These markings are crucial for authentication. Look for the Chanel signature, typically a stylized double "C" logo, often accompanied by other markings indicating the metal's purity (e.g., 18K for 18-karat gold) and sometimes the maker's mark. These markings are usually subtly etched, not stamped, and their placement varies depending on the piece and era. The presence and clarity of these hallmarks are paramount. Faded or poorly executed markings are a significant red flag.
* Construction Quality: Chanel's commitment to exceptional craftsmanship is evident in the meticulous construction of their jewelry. Examine the piece closely for inconsistencies in metalwork, soldering, or stone setting. Loose stones, uneven finishes, or poorly aligned components are strong indicators of a counterfeit. The overall feel of the piece – its weight, balance, and solidity – should reflect the quality of materials used.
* Materials: Genuine Chanel jewelry uses high-quality materials. The gold should have a rich, lustrous sheen, and the gemstones, if present, should exhibit excellent clarity and cut. Pay close attention to the details; counterfeiters often cut corners by using inferior metals or synthetic stones.
* Packaging and Documentation: While not always present, original Chanel boxes, cases, and accompanying documentation can significantly strengthen the authenticity of a piece. These elements, if available, should be carefully examined for consistency with the era of the jewelry. However, the absence of original packaging does not automatically invalidate a piece, especially with older items.
* Expert Appraisal: For particularly valuable or questionable pieces, seeking the expertise of a professional appraiser specializing in Chanel jewelry is highly recommended. A qualified appraiser can conduct a thorough examination and provide a definitive assessment of authenticity.
